What Is Sclerotherapy?

Sclerotherapy is the process of injecting a specialized fluid directly into the afflicted veins. The solution irritates the vein walls, causing them to collapse and resorb into the body. Its primary function is to improve appearance and relieve symptoms such as swelling, aching, and cramping.

Who Is a Good Candidate for Sclerotherapy?

Individuals with obvious varicose or spider veins who are in good general health are good candidates for this procedure. However, pregnant women and anyone with certain blood coagulation issues may need to avoid this treatment. Post-treatment Care for Sclerotherapy

Once the procedure is over, we will discuss post-treatment care with you, including the following tips:

  • Compression Stockings: Wearing compression stockings for several days may improve the results, as well as help you avoid any issues.
  • Avoid Sun Exposure: To avoid discoloration, treated areas should be kept out of direct sunlight.
  • Follow-Up Sessions: Depending on the severity, follow-up sessions may be needed to get the best results.
